Secrets of the Skinny

Doctor OzI’ve been very impressed with The Doctor Oz Show. I like his common sense approach to getting healthy and staying healthy. This morning’s show was no exception. Three women were guests on his show. They each lost over 100 pounds and kept it off. They found the “Secrets of the Skinny” that worked for them. And they’re willing to share those secrets with Doctor Oz and his audience. Here are the secrets . . .

Cravings Killers

  • Brown rice tortilla, lightly toasted (baked) with salsa or parmesan

Metabolism Boosters

  • Cayenne pepper, sprinkle on food or supplements
  • Vitamin B Complex
  • Cinnamon, 1/2 teaspoon a day.

Must Have Meals

Weight Loss Secret Weapons

  • Learn to grade food.

          A = Fresh green beans out of the garden
          B = Frozen beans changed a little
          C = Canned green beans cooked – A little altered
          D = Processed
          F = Grandma’s green bean casserole

  • Use cans of food as weights. Lift weights while watching TV
  • Work out with a weighted vest. The more weight you have on your body, the more calories you burn.

The women had words of wisdom for the audience:

  • Becky’s advice: “I changed the way I looked at food. Food became nutrition.”
  • Cari’s advice: “Start slow and stick with it. Make plans and hold yourself accountable. Definitely have support … Have supportive people around you.”
  • When Doctor Oz asked what kept her motivated, Caroline answered, “There’s no such thing as the impossible.”
